Game Day Logistics & Location

Where will the Chiefs Bills game be played in 2026?

The exact location for the 2026 Chiefs Bills game is not yet confirmed. It will most likely be held at either Arrowhead Stadium in Kansas City, Missouri, or Highmark Stadium in Orchard Park, New York. The NFL announces its full schedule, including specific venues, typically in May of the preceding year.

What is the typical rotation for home and away games in this rivalry?

Teams generally alternate home and away games against non-division conference opponents over a two-year cycle. If the Chiefs hosted in 2025, the Bills would likely host in 2026, and vice versa. However, special circumstances or league decisions can occasionally alter this general pattern.

Rivalry History & Significance

Why is the Chiefs Bills rivalry so intense?

The Chiefs Bills rivalry has intensified due to frequent high-stakes playoff matchups and the consistent elite performance of both teams and their star quarterbacks. Recent seasons have seen them clash in crucial AFC Championship games, creating a modern classic rivalry. Both fan bases are incredibly passionate, fueling the competition.

Myth vs Reality: Is this a historically old rivalry?

Myth: The Chiefs Bills rivalry is one of the oldest and most consistently fierce in NFL history.
Reality: While they have faced each other many times, the *intensity* of the rivalry significantly escalated in the 2020s due to their consistent presence at the top of the AFC and multiple playoff battles. It's a modern classic, rather than an ancient one like Bears-Packers.

14. Q: Could the 2026 Chiefs Bills game be part of an NFL Kickoff Game or Thanksgiving slate?
A: That's a fantastic advanced thought, considering the league's biggest stages! It's definitely within the realm of possibility for a Chiefs-Bills matchup to be selected for one of these coveted slots. The NFL Kickoff Game, which opens the season, typically features the reigning Super Bowl champion at home. If either the Chiefs or Bills claim the Super Bowl title in 2025, they'd be a prime candidate to host the opener, and a rival like the other team would make an excellent opponent. Similarly, Thanksgiving Day games are traditionally high-profile events. The league loves compelling narratives for these slots, and this rivalry certainly fits the bill.
